What is an engineer?
Engineers design, build, and maintain the functional aspects of a product, structure, or system for their specific engineering industry. Their specific job description relates to all of the detailed tasks, responsibilities, skills, and education requirements that a company or organization requires for their engineering specialty. For example, electrical engineers develop, monitor, and test electrical systems. Civil engineers design, construct, and maintain large infrastructure projects, such as highways, bridges, and airports. Many engineers begin their career with an internship or apprenticeship while they are still in school, and then acquire an entry-level position. As they learn more about the industry, engineers are given their own projects and more responsibility.

What is the difference between Engineer vs Technician?
| Aspect | Engineer | Technician |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Bachelor's degree in engineering or related field | Technical diploma or associate degree |
| Work Environment | Design, planning, analysis, project management | Installation, maintenance, troubleshooting |
| Industry Usage | Design firms, manufacturing, construction | Field service, manufacturing plants, maintenance teams |
| Common Search/Comparison | Engineer vs Technician |
Engineers typically hold a bachelor's degree and focus on designing, analyzing, and managing projects. Technicians usually have technical diplomas and handle hands-on install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ting. While engineers plan and oversee, technicians implement and support. Both roles are essential in engineering projects, but they differ in education, responsibilities, and work environment.

Transportation Engineer II, III, or IV (Bridge/Hydraulic Engineer) - TP&D
Laredo, TX • On-site
Full-time
Posted 4 days ago
Texas Department Of Transportation rating
8.6
Based on 39 frontline employees who took The Breakroom Quiz
203rd of 854 rated public administrative organizations
Job description
Performs complex transportation engineering work in one or more functional areas such as planning, project development and design, construction, transportation/traffic operations and/or maintenance. Ensures compliance with applicable federal and state laws, policies, procedures, standards and guidelines. Work requires contact with governmental officials and private entities. Employees at this level perform work independently on assignments; however all unusual issues are referred to the supervisor.
Essential Duties:- Assists with design, computer operations and plan preparation.
- Assists districts with bridge inspection-related matters
- Performs engineering design work such as development of layouts, sketches, plans, specifications, estimates and contracts.
- Reviews designs and detailed drawings of bridges and related structures prepared by other engineers and technicians.
- Recommends bridge replacement, bridge rehabilitation and repair of damaged bridges.
- Designs complex bridge projects and performs specialized design.
- Provides technical assistance in drainage design, resolution of drainage complaints, hydraulics evaluations and other hydrology matters.
- Utilizes project management principles in initiating, planning, executing, monitoring, and closing for transportation projects.
- Serves as a project manager overseeing consultants performing advanced and complex engineering work.
- Monitors consultants' progress and work quality; checks invoices and associated documents; prepares supplemental agreements
- Performs other job responsibilities as assigned.
Bachelor's Degree in engineering or related science bachelor's or higher degree accepted by TX PELS.
Experience:Transportation Engineer II:
5 years engineering, transportation engineering, or related engineering experience
Transportation Engineer III
6 years engineering, transportation engineering, or related engineering experience
Transportation Engineer IV
7 years engineering, transportation engineering, or related engineering experience
(Experience can be satisfied by full time or prorated part time equivalent). Related graduate level education may be substituted for experience on a year per year basis. Substitutions for Minimum Qualifications
Licenses and Certifications:Valid US driver's license at time of application.
Licensed Professional Engineer*
For Bridge Inspection: Must have completed a comprehensive training course based on the Bridge Inspector's Training Manual or NICET Level III or IV certification in Bridge Safety Inspection within (1) year of date of hire.
*Professional engineers licensed in another state in the United States, but not currently licensed in the State of Texas, must (1) meet the license requirements of the State of Texas Engineering Practices Act, (2) obtain a professional engineering license from the State of Texas within six (6) months of the date of hire, and (3) sign an agreement to that effect as a condition of employment.
